The British Home Guard was created in 1940 in response to fears of a German invasion and was disbanded in 1945 after the war ended. But what if the Labour government decided to retain or reraise the organisation after 1945 as a hedge against future threats in the emerging Cold War in a manner similar to the Scandinavian countries?
Obviously this won't have a major effect on history as there's never been a World War Three, but how would such a force be structured and how long would it last and what, if any, effects would it have on the British way of life?
There was a brief revival of the Home Guard idea during the 1980's, when an organisation called the Home Service Force was raised from ex-servicemen and reservists to provide extra security for strategic points in the UK.
